IN MESOPOTAMIA
IMPROVED SITUATION REPORTED. (Rec. August 25, 7.30 p.m.) London, August 24. Tho War Office reports that in Mesopotamia the situation has improved. Tho areas north-east ami north of tfagdad are quiet. A strong body of tribesmen made several attacks on a party of bikhs covering blockhouse-construction south of Hillah. The attackers were beaten otf with heavy losses. Our casualties wcro forty.—Router., r
